Bunker FB 3 Seraing

Bunker FB 3 is the last remainging bunker of the sector of Flémalles-Boncelles.

The sector would hold a line of 5 km and is part of the 2nd line of defense for the city of Liège (la Position Fortifiée de Liège, PFL 2).

Bunkers FB 1, FB2 and FB 2 bis are demolished after the war.

The bunker is located at Marchandise Wood at Seraing. Although the bunkers is near the road, it is not visible due to the trees. Even not in Winter. The bunker would had a perfect view on the surrounding area of Seraing.

The bunker has two gunopenings. One for a 47 mm anti-tank canon, and one for a machinegun. Also this bunker would have a turret. This was roufly cut out of the bunker after the war. Photo 4.

When after the war the bunkers lost their strategic importance for the defence of Belgium, the turret, iron shutters and doors were sold as scrap.
